This episode is one from the archives, and this time I’m handing the microphone over to my friend and colleague Monique Carmen, who sat down with the wonderful Dr Asa Hershoff.Asa is a homeopath, writer and one of those rare thinkers who can take homeopathy far beyond remedies and symptoms, into the deeper terrain of psychology, intuition, ancient wisdom and what it really means to treat the whole person.This is not a neat, tidy conversation. It is philosophical, slightly wild in places and deeply thought-provoking.We go into Asa’s early journey into natural medicine, the healer who changed the course of his life, his first encounter with homeopathy and why he came to understand illness as something far more meaningful than a list of symptoms.We talk about radionics, remedy machines, Tibetan Buddhism, the five elements, chakras, intuition, energetic medicine and the difference between treating the surface and meeting the person underneath.One of the most powerful parts of the conversation is Asa’s explanation of homeopathy as a kind of mirror.
